Thanks to OleoZE, sustainable agriculture is paying off

OleoZE is the first online seed purchasing solution that compensates farmers for their environmentally friendly practices. In particular, it promotes soil conservation activities and the traceability of greenhouse gases on farms.

Avril supports new models promoting the value of the sustainable agronomic practices of farmers. These models positively impact the environment, the planet, and agriculture itself. OleoZE, short for Oleo Zero Emission, represents a concrete example. Introduced by Saipol, OleoZE is the first online purchase solution for rapeseed and sunflower seeds that compensates farmers for their sustainable practices, such as planting cover crops and limiting ploughing. In addition, it enables tracking and quantifying greenhouse gas (GHG) reductions from farms according to a unique model approved by the Intergovernmental Panel on Climate Change (IPCC).

Thanks to this responsible sourcing, Saipol is strengthening the traceability of oilseeds all the way back to the farm and sharing the value of the service provided to farmers. The bonus varies depending on the GHG savings achieved by the farmer. Its average value in 2021 amounted to €23 per ton of rapeseed or sunflower harvested. Farmers are paid either directly or through their storage organizations. The OleoZE website underwent a makeover in the summer of 2021 making it even easier to use. This now enables users to determine their potential eligibility and access seed prices prior to making a commitment.

Guillaume de La Forest,

Market Analyst at Saipol

"For the past two seasons, Saipol has also been testing the growing of camelina, a short-cycle oilseed, with the aim of producing "green", renewable biofuel during the periods when cereal crops are not being grown in rotation. This pilot project offers an interesting opportunity to transform a vegetation cover into bioenergy."
